Abstract

The invention discloses a mulberry planting and cultivating method and relates to the technical field of planting. The method mainly comprises a cultivation technique and a management method, wherein the cultivation technique mainly comprises a, cultivated field selection and b, seedling culture; the management method mainly comprises A, irrigation and drainage, B, fertilizer application and C, plant disease and insect pest control. The mulberry planting and cultivating method has the beneficial effects that fine culture and maintenance are carried out at each phase of planting mulberry saplings, the rate of survival of the saplings at each phase is fully ensured, and the economic losses are reduced.

Embodiment:
For technological means, creation characteristic that the present invention is realized, reach object and effect is easy to understand, below in conjunction with instantiation, further set forth the present invention.
Mulberry tree plantation breeding method, mainly comprises culture technique and management method:
Culture technique mainly comprises: a: planting site is selected, b: grow seedlings;
Management method mainly comprises: A: irrigation and drainage; B: fertilising; C: administer damage by disease and insect;
Planting site is selected, select that earth's surface is comparatively smooth, scope enough greatly, blackland that ground surface soil is comparatively lax;
Grow seedlings, before and after the beginning of spring, on the planting site of choosing, interval 4*4m digs pit anyhow, cheats greatlyr than native ball, and sapling is planted in hole, bankets, and waters;
Irrigation and drainage, novel species sapling, waters once for 7 days, guarantees that the page is moistening, and after coming into leaves, also micro-volume waters, and want timely draining rainy season, prevents that root system is immersed in water for a long time;
Fertilising, piss element or two ammonium 21kg/ mus after germinateing; Treat the relieving of sapling young leaves, enter Chang Cu Ye Qi,Sa composite fertilizer 21kg/ mu; Later stage was sprayed fertilizer every 2 months to tree, and in fertilizer, comprising percentage by weight is nitrogen 25%, phosphorus pentoxide 9.7%, potassium oxide 21%, calcium oxide 23%.Magnesia 19%, boron 1%, copper oxide 1%, zinc 1.4%, iron 1.3%;
Damage by disease and insect prevents, adopts 60% powder of carbendazim 1000 liquid to spray to treat powdery mildew; With Chinese herbal medicine kuh-seng, extract matrine, every mu of kuh-seng 2kg, adds water and endures to 5kg, then while adding poach 1 hour to the surplus 3~5kg of liquid medicine, adds 20kg spraying killing aphids.
The fertilising stage, at sapling both sides trench digging, 10~15 centimetres of ditch width, 2~4 centimetres of ditch depths; At low water, it is irrigated, and in the rainwater phase, in ditch, with every mu, spreads 5kg fertilizer.
Ditch is opened at 50cm place, sapling both sides.
In the seedling grow phase, water mode for to water by seedling.
